Pokémon Go: Best Moveset and Counters for Tepig

Guide for the best counters against Tepig during the Battle Raids!

Tepig is a fire-type Pokémon who looks like a pig and is generally orange in color. It has oval eyes, a red colored nose with long pointed ears which are placed closely. Tepig has short legs and the upper portion of the head is dark brown. It has a deep yellow stripe on its snout and its curly tail is finished with a confounded red sphere. In this Pokémon Go Guide, we will go over the best movesets and counters for defeating Tepig.

Tepig in Pokémon Go

Also known as the Fire Pig Pokémon, it is vulnerable to Water, Ground, and Rock and is capable of powering up his Fire-type move when his HP is low. At Level 17, the Pokémon can evolve to Pignite at the expense of 25 candies, and at Level 36, the Pokémon will have the potential of evolving to Emboar costing 100 candies.

It can be obtained from 571 to 618 CP at level 20 with no weather boost. The Pokémon can also be obtained at level 25 with a CP value from 714 to 773 CP with the weather boost. Currently, in Pokémon Go, there are a total of 3 Pokémon in the Tepig Family.

The best movesets for Tepig are Ember and Flamethrower. The Pokémon’s quick moves include Ember and Tackle while the main moves consist of Flamethrower, Flame Charge, and Body Slam.

Best counters against Tepig in Pokémon Go

Below is the list of best counters for Tepig in Pokémon Go.

  • Blastoise (Mega): Water Gun/Hydro Cannon
  • Aerodactyl (Mega): Rock Throw/Ancient Power
  • Gyarados (Mega): Waterfall/Aqua Tail
  • Alakazam (Mega): Confusion/Psychic
  • Gengar (Mega): Shadow Claw/Shadow Ball
  • Rampardos: Smack Down/Rock Slide
  • Terrakion: Smack Down/Rock Slide
  • Landorus (Incarnate): Rock Throw/Earth Power
  • Rhyperior: Smack Down/Rock Wrecker
  • Greninja: Bubble/Hydro Pump
  • Landorus (Therian): Mud Shot/Stone Edge
  • Kyogre: Waterfall/Surf 
  • Clawdaunt: Waterfall/Crabhammer
  • Simipoar: Water Gun/Hydro Pump
  • Floatzel: Water Gun/Hydro Pump
  • Houndoom (Mega): Snarl/Crunch 
  • Beedrill (Mega): Bug Bite/Sludge Bomb
  • Steelix (Mega): Thunder Fang/Earthquake
  • Vaporeon: Water Gun/Hydro Pump
  • Krookodile: Snarl/Earthquake
  • Feraligatr: Water Gun/Hydro Cannon
  • Kingdra: Water Gun/Hydro Pump
  • Starmie: Water Gun/Hydro Pump
  • Omastar: Water Gun/Hydro Pump
  • Swampert: Mud Shot/Hydro Cannon
  • Excadrill: Mud Shot/Earthquake
  • Palkia: Dragon Breath/Aqua Tail
  • Groudon: Mud Shot/Earthquake
